HELP! I don't want to get out of bed. December 29, 2006 Jomy V. Muttathil (Long Island, NY USA) 40 out of 40 found this review helpful
I'm writing this review from my bed which I now find to be so comfortable, I don't want to get up. I originally bought this to put on a hard futon that guests sleep on. But I found it to be so comfortable that I'm using it on my bed now. It arrived compressed and needed about 24 hours to expand to its full size. Even at its full size, it is a 1-2" smaller than my queen size mattress. I think this is on purpose so that your fitted sheets will still fit. It did smell a little but that went away in a few days. I recommend airing it out in the garage or on a patio. I have been using it for a month now and I has definitely improved my sleep. I used to toss and turn a lot more. I would wake up in the middle of the night and find my arm was numb. Now the bed conforms to me and I feel less pressure points. My wife also feels she gets better quality sleep on this mattress and doesn't feel as achy when she wakes up.

What you should know about memory foam in general April 22, 2008 Brandon K. Holmes (Iowa City, Iowa USA) 12 out of 13 found this review helpful
First of all, sleeping on high quality memory foam is a dream. Perfect amount of support on anything you put on it. I put a 2" toppper on an 8 year old futon that you could feel the frame under it and it was like sleeping on my parents $5500 bed. *Two Things* you have to know, density is everything. 3lb is cheap, 4lb is average and 5lb is premium. 2lb has no 'memory' to it thus very little support. Easy to push in and it basically comes back out instantly. Second is...IT AGES. I'm on my second Serta 4lb topper and both were awesome until about 8 months before I noticed that there's less and less 'memory'. At 11 months, it feels like 2lb foam that doesn't provide a lot of support but rather foam you would think you'd pack stuff with. I compared areas that would be compressed often and the most to unused corners (near the feet) and there was some but very little difference. So it seems use isn't the factor but rather age. I stuck a glass object on it and measured the depth it sank and was going to measure the time it took to sink but it was basically instantaneous compared to when it was new when it would sink like somebody in quicksand (can you tell I'm an engineer...). So memory foam...Awesome...but has a shelf life. Something to keep in mind when considering to go foam.
